By: tenthije - 7th June 2009 at 12:08
I’d pull it if I where you:
1) Dust spot to the right of the aircraft nose near the border.
2) Oversharpened: registration on wing
3) Soft: wingtips, rear fuselage.
4) Bad-center: too high in the frame.
